Ernst Lippert is a scholar working on Physical and Theoretical Chemistry, Atomic and Molecular Physics, and Optics and Organic Chemistry. According to data from OpenAlex, Ernst Lippert has authored 24 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Physical and Theoretical Chemistry, 7 papers in Atomic and Molecular Physics, and Optics and 7 papers in Organic Chemistry. Recurrent topics in Ernst Lippert’s work include Photochemistry and Electron Transfer Studies (10 papers), Spectroscopy and Quantum Chemical Studies (5 papers) and Thermodynamic properties of mixtures (3 papers). Ernst Lippert is often cited by papers focused on Photochemistry and Electron Transfer Studies (10 papers), Spectroscopy and Quantum Chemical Studies (5 papers) and Thermodynamic properties of mixtures (3 papers). Ernst Lippert collaborates with scholars based in Germany and Austria. Ernst Lippert's co-authors include Helmut Prigge, Wolfgang Rettig, Martin Vögel, Harald Otto, Otto S. Wolfbeis, A. A. Ayuk, Helmut Schwarz, K.‐H. Naumann, Wolffram Schröer and Ulrich D. Jentschura and has published in prestigious journals such as Accounts of Chemical Research, Chemical Physics and Helvetica Chimica Acta.
